基於【 Docker】六 || 部署Harbor倉庫

第一步:下載harbor二進制文件:https://github.com/goharbor/harbor/releases 

第二步:安裝 docker compose

sudo curl -L https://github.com/docker/compose/releases/download/1.22.0/docker-compose-$(uname -s)-$(uname -m) -o /usr/local/bin/docker-compose

而後把下載的docker-compose 設置可執行權限python

chmod +x /usr/local/bin/docker-compose

第三步:此處應該設置自簽證書的,即訪問的時候是採用HTTPS進行訪問的。此處略去,不影響咱們接下去的部署。(後期會出一篇關於自簽證書的文章,僅供參考)

第四步:將下載好的Harbor二進制包上傳到服務器上面,而後解壓出來

tar xzvf 包名

第五步:進入解壓出來的文件夾harbor中,配置文件harbor.yml

vi harbor.yml

把其中的hostname修改成:IP地址。c++

而後 修改harbor的登陸密碼。git

第六步:在當前文件夾中開啓harbor

./prepare
./install.sh 

第七步:啓動成功,查看一下

docker-compose ps
經過web界面登陸harbor http://ip地址

備註 :yum install  lrzsz -y 命令 rz Xshell上傳文件
gcc更新到6.3.1
yum -y install centos-release-scl
yum -y install devtoolset-6-gcc devtoolset-6-gcc-c++ devtoolset-6-binutils
scl enable devtoolset-6 bash
echo "source /opt/rh/devtoolset-6/enable" >>/etc/profile

  更新python35github

# 查看安裝的包
scl -l 
yum -y install rh-python35
scl enable rh-python35 bash
echo "source /opt/rh/rh-python35/enable" >>/etc/profile
相關文章
相關標籤/搜索